**Ticket: Orders soft-delete flag missing in support sandbox**

The sandbox for Cartwheel Orders was built without `ORDERS_SOFT_DELETE=true`, so support's test deletions were permanent. This has been corrected; deleted rows now get a `removed_at` timestamp and stay queryable for 30 days. The purge job that hard-deletes expired rows authenticates against the archive service, and its credential is set on the next line of the env file.

secret setting of hawep-yahig: LEDGER_TOKEN29=41b5d6315371c92885eaeb077fb63

For Quillbrook's print pipeline we vendor third-party fonts into the build rather than fetching at runtime, removing an external dependency and the associated supply-chain surface. Each font file is checksummed at import and re-verified at build time; mismatches fail the pipeline. License metadata is stored alongside the binaries for audit. For review, the verification thresholds and cache parameters are defined as follows.

tuning table, kajog-bawip:
TIERS = {
    "kelius": 256,
    "lammir": 543,
}

Subject: DR drill results — Fixturely test-data factory

Team,

Ahead of Thursday's sync: the disaster-recovery drill for the Fixturely library went well. We rebuilt the seed catalog from backups in 40 minutes, within target. One gap: the factory's snapshot store requires manual unlock after restore, which stalled us briefly. For future drills, the on-call engineer should unlock the store using the recovery passphrase noted below.

unlock words, fajof-kahip: ulaath-zorael-drumir

Handover note — spare hardware room

Hi Petra, before I head off: the spare hardware store is Room 2.18, past the print hub on the east corridor. Everything's shelved by type — monitors on the left, docks and cables in the grey bins, laptops in the locked cabinet (key's taped inside the door frame, I know, I know). Log anything you take out on the clipboard so Finn can reconcile stock monthly. The door keypad code you'll need is below.

staff pass of kawip-hawef = bdg-QLP-2